This function block describes the functionality of the Atmosphere Pressure Sensor
measuring part of the gauge.
The PSG55x and some variants of the PCG55x do not have a Atmos-
phere Pressure Sensor (ATM) and this function block (ATM) is not sup-
ported.

Adjust Command
Name
Description
0
2…255
Reserved
Reserved, no action
1
Gain Adjust If this service is performed, the ATM sensor
value will be set to the same value as at that
time measured by the diaphragm gauge.
Target value
Description
0…255 Not
available
To perform the Gain Adjust vent to atmosphere and then start the Gain Adjust
Service.
